- Title
Proton pump inhibitors suppress absorption of dietary non-haem iron in hereditary haemochromatosis.
- Authors
Hutchinson, Carol; Geissler, Catherine A; Powell, Jonathan J; Bomford, Adrian
- Abstract
During the long-term treatment of patients with hereditary haemochromatosis (HH) the authors observed that proton pump inhibitors (PPI) reduced the requirement for maintenance phlebotomy. Gastric acid plays a crucial role in non-haem iron absorption and the authors performed a case review and intervention study to investigate if PPI-induced suppression of gastric acid would reduce dietary iron absorption in C282Y homozygous patients.
